Search: Partner Contact Email Phone Partner description
- EURAC Roberto Fedrizzi roberto.fedrizzi[at]eurac.edu +39 0471 055 610 The Institute for Renewable Energy conducts applied research in the fields of solar energy and energy efficiency in buildings. Based in Italy. Project coordinator and leader of Work Packages 1 & 6.
- CARTIF Andres Macia andmac[at]cartif.es +34 983 548 911 Technology centre covering a wide range of scientific disciplines. Based in Spain. Leaders of Work Package 5.
- ZAFH Romain Nouvel romain.nouvel[at]hft-stuttgart.de +49 711 8926 2950 Centre for Applied Research at Universities of Applied Sciences - Sustainable Energy Technology, ZAFH.net works in interdisciplinary research groups on innovative energy concepts and energy management solutions. Based in Germany. Leaders of Work Package 4.
- SERC Chris Bales cba[at]du.se +46 23 778707 Solar Energy Research Centre- a working group within the energy and environmental technology department at Dalarna University College. Based in Sweden.
- FhG-ISE Bruno Bueno bruno.bueno[at]ise.fraunhofer.de +49 761 4588 5377 FhG-ISE: The largest solar energy research institute in Europe. The work at the Institute ranges from the investigation of scientific and technological fundamentals for solar energy applications, through the development of production technology and prototypes, to the construction of demonstration systems. Based in Germany. Leaders of Work Package 3.
